Upholding International Compliance via Strict ISO and UN38.3 Certifications

In the realm of energy production, adherence with global standards is the bedrock of security and reliability. Our manufacturing processes are strictly aligned with ISO-9001 certification, which signifies a strong dedication to quality control practices that are recognized globally. This certification guarantees that every stage of our assembly process, from raw component procurement to end construction, is recorded, tracked, and constantly improved. It reduces variability in manufacturing, meaning that the first pack off the assembly is just as dependable as the thousandth. For clients looking for a high-performance Lithium Battery Pack, this degree of certified quality offers peace of mind that the item will function securely and consistently, irrespective of the size of the shipment.

Beyond quality control, security during shipping and usage is validated by UN-38.3 testing. This critical requirement entails exposing cells to severe trials, comprising altitude checks, temperature changes, vibration, shock, and outside short circuit assessments. Solely products that survive these rigorous exams are considered safe for global shipping and installation. Compliance with these rules is essential for any business that plans to ship products across borders or utilize flight freight, as it confirms that the power storage unit is stable in harsh situations. By keeping these credentials, we remove legal obstacles for our clients, enabling them to concentrate on their core business realizing that their power parts meet the highest safety benchmarks in the industry.

Providing Tailored Power Options from 12V to 72-Volt for Various Industry Demands

One specification rarely suits all in the complex field of industrial electronics and EV mobility, which is why customization is at the core of our service. We specialize in designing and building battery solutions that cover a wide power spectrum, specifically from 12V units up to high-capacity 72V setups. This flexibility permits us to cater to a multitude of applications, be it energizing automated guidance vehicles (AGVs), electric forklifts, leisure RVs, or advanced robotics. Each voltage requirement brings its own collection of challenges regarding battery layout, current delivery, and safety systems, and our staff is adept at structuring the ideal design for each particular use case.

For commercial applications where downtime equals to lost revenue, utilizing a power pack that is custom-built for the specific load profile of the machinery is essential. Off-the-shelf units frequently miss the required power capacity or cycle life needed for heavy everyday operations. The custom method ensures that a 72-volt system for an EV bike, for example, is optimized distinctly than a 12-volt system intended for sun energy backup. We consider into account variables such as continuous drain rates, peak power bursts, and dimensional limits to provide a product that integrates seamlessly. This degree of personalization empowers our customers to create without being limited by the constraints of standard power products.
